THE ROLE

We are currently hiring a Personal Assistant to help support our London Leadership team, on a 12-month fixed term contract.

The role requires someone who is organised, proactive and an excellent multitasker.

In this role, you’ll be providing invaluable support to leaders within the business, working at pace to meet the demands of our fast paced agency.

This is a great opportunity for an experienced PA looking to develop their career.

You'll have significant exposure to our Senior Executives, while partnering with colleagues across a variety of disciplines throughout the agency.

This breadth of exposure offers the opportunity to build relationships across multiple functions and gain insight into a diverse range of specialisms and ways of working.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Own diary management for senior stakeholders: Help those you support prioritise their time, forward‑planning weeks ahead for both internal & external meetings, and spot & resolve clashes.
  • Act as a first point of contact: Proactively respond to requests, greet clients & external partners, support with ad‑hoc inbox management
  • Run meeting logistics flawlessly: Book rooms, manage catering, set‑up & test tech, share links and pre‑reads, and support with follow‑up actions.
  • Coordinate travel: Flights/trains, hotels, transfers, visas (where required), detailed itineraries, and contingency planning when plans change.
  • Support offsites and key agency events: Venue sourcing, agendas, materials, attendee coordination, dinner bookings, and follow‑up actions.
  • Manage finance/admin processes: Raise POs, process invoices, complete timesheets, support with absence management, and handle expenses accurately and on time.
  • Support interview scheduling and onboarding: Coordinate with People team and Ogilvy TA team to confirm interviews, prep calendars/rooms, and help shape smooth induction plans for new starters.
  • Keep information organised and findable: Maintain contacts, distribution lists, filing systems, and meeting documentation with a tidy, consistent approach.
  • Support as a Team Assistant: Pitch in on agency moments - culture, socials, training, events, organising our studio showcases and content for our weekly all‑agency.
  • Ensure smooth running of the office: Order stationary, co‑ordinate food shops for our floor, be a point person for ad‑hoc requests.
  • Handle ad hoc requests with pace and judgement: Focus on finding solutions and maintain discretion around the tasks you are supporting with.
  • WHAT YOU WILL NEED
  • Proven experience as a senior PA within a creative or media agency, or a similarly fast‑paced industry.
  • A track record of brilliant diary management: Confident juggling multiple stakeholders, shifting priorities, and tight deadlines.
  • Strong “manage upwards” instincts: You can take direction, but you’re also comfortable raising flags, offering options, and protecting focus/time.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ication: Whether you’re emailing a client, or checking‑in with a team in the agency, your’re able to adapt your tone & style accordingly to build relationships.
  • High attention to detail: Able to spot & execute the small things (times, locations, links, time zones, access, prep) that make everything run smoothly.
  • Sound judgement and discretion: Trusted with sensitive information; you know what’s confidential, what’s urgent, and what needs escalation.
  • Calm & Resourceful: You’re able to stay level‑headed, practical and positive when plans change last minute, adapting to what’s needed and moving forwards.
  • Solid tech capability: Comfortable with learning and using AI tools, Outlook, Teams, and Microsoft Office (Word, Power Point, Excel).

You’re quick to learn new tools and troubleshoot basics.

  • A genuinely collaborative mindset: You’re a team player who wants the agency to thrive, so throw your hand‑up to support when needed.
